AI Summary

  • Requires candidates endorsed in municipal primary elections to sign certification documents submitted to town clerks, with certification deadlines ranging from 48 to 132 days before elections depending on office type.

  • Mandates that candidates for state elections sign certificates of endorsement filed with the Secretary of the State or town clerk, including their name as authorized for the ballot, full street address, and office title/district.

  • Directs the Secretary of the State to create and provide standardized certification forms to town clerks that include prompts for candidate signatures, printed names, full street addresses, and other required nomination information.

  • Establishes that certifications not received by the Secretary of the State or town clerk by specified deadlines are invalid and parties are deemed to have made no endorsement or nomination.

  • Provides a grace period allowing certifications without candidate signatures if the Secretary of the State has not yet made the standardized form available.

Legislative Description

An Act Concerning Certification Of Candidates.
